Mexican Corn Dip
•4 cans (11 Oz. Can) Mexicorn, Drained
•1 cup Hellman's Mayonnaise
•8 ounces, weight Sour Cream
•3 whole Large Jalapenos, Seeds Removed And Chopped
•1 bunch Green Onions, Chopped
•1 bag (8 Oz. Bag) Mexican Blend Shredded Cheese
•1 teaspoon Cumin, Or To Taste
Mix all the ingredients together and serve with Frito Scoops. YUMMY!
